The Shimano GRX RD-RX820 [paid link] (12-speed 2x) rear derailleur is an essential component for any road bike, providing precise and reliable shifting performance. Proper alignment of the derailleur hanger is crucial to ensure smooth and accurate shifting, as even slight misalignments can cause chain skipping, poor shifting, and excessive wear. This guide will walk you through the necessary steps to align your GRX RD-RX820 rear derailleur hanger at home, including the tools required, the alignment process, and troubleshooting common issues.

Step 1: Inspect the Hanger for Damage
Before attempting any alignment, it is essential to check if the derailleur hanger is bent or damaged. A misaligned or bent hanger will not only cause shifting issues but could also damage the frame or derailleur. Carefully inspect the hanger for any visible bends, cracks, or wear.
- Visual Inspection: Look for any visible signs of damage or bending. Pay special attention to the points where the hanger attaches to the frame.
- Derailleur Alignment Check: Attach the derailleur to the hanger and see if it sits parallel to the wheel’s cogset. If the derailleur is visibly angled, it’s likely that the hanger is misaligned.
If the hanger is damaged beyond repair, you will need to replace it before proceeding with any further adjustments.

Step 3: Use the Hanger Alignment Tool
A hanger alignment tool is the most effective way to assess and adjust derailleur hanger alignment. This tool will help you identify whether the hanger is skewed left or right in relation to the wheel.
- Attach the Tool: Secure the hanger alignment tool to the derailleur hanger. The tool should make contact with the outer face of the hanger.
- Assess Alignment: Rotate the tool or check its position to see if the hanger is aligned with the wheel’s axis. If the tool indicates misalignment, you will need to proceed with adjustment.
Step 4: Adjust the Hanger Alignment
If you find that the hanger is misaligned, it’s time to make the necessary adjustments.
- Loosen the Fasteners: Use a 5mm hex wrench to loosen the bolts securing the derailleur hanger to the frame. You only need to loosen them slightly—just enough to allow for movement.
- Straighten the Hanger: Gently adjust the hanger using your hands or an adjustable spanner to move it back into alignment. You can use the alignment tool to ensure it is straight relative to the wheel.
- Check Alignment Again: After making adjustments, verify the alignment with the tool. Ensure that the hanger is perpendicular to the rear wheel axle and parallel to the cogset.
- Tighten the Bolts: Once the hanger is aligned, use the torque wrench to tighten the fasteners to the manufacturer’s recommended torque specification. Over-tightening can cause damage, so be cautious.
Step 5: Test the Derailleur Movement
After the hanger is aligned, it’s essential to test the derailleur’s movement to ensure proper operation.
- Shift Through Gears: Shift the bike through the gears and ensure that the derailleur moves smoothly and accurately across the cassette.
- Check for Chain Rub: Inspect the chain to ensure it doesn’t rub against the derailleur cage. Any rubbing may indicate that the hanger is still slightly misaligned or that the derailleur needs additional adjustment.
Step 6: Fine-Tuning the Rear Derailleur
If the derailleur is still not shifting properly after alignment, you may need to fine-tune the rear derailleur settings.
- Adjust the Limit Screws: Use a 3mm hex wrench to adjust the low and high limit screws on the rear derailleur. These screws control the derailleur’s range of movement and ensure it doesn’t overshift or cause the chain to drop off.
- Indexing Adjustment: If the derailleur moves too slowly or skips gears, you may need to adjust the indexing using the barrel adjuster on the derailleur or shifter.
Troubleshooting Common Hanger Alignment Issues
Even after aligning the derailleur hanger, you may encounter some issues that require further attention. Here are some common problems and their solutions:
Issue 1: Persistent Chain Skipping
- Possible Cause: If your chain skips despite alignment, it may be due to a bent hanger that was not fully straightened or a worn-out derailleur.
- Solution: Recheck the alignment with the tool and ensure the derailleur is positioned correctly. If the issue persists, inspect the derailleur for wear and replace it if necessary.
Issue 2: Chain Rubbing on Derailleur
- Possible Cause: If the chain rubs on the derailleur cage, the derailleur hanger might still be misaligned, or the derailleur itself could be incorrectly installed.
- Solution: Recheck the alignment of the hanger and ensure the derailleur is properly mounted and adjusted. Check the derailleur hanger’s positioning using the tool.
Issue 3: Derailleur Shifting Too Slowly
- Possible Cause: Slow shifting may occur due to misadjusted derailleur limits, cable tension, or a bent derailleur hanger.
- Solution: First, confirm the alignment using the hanger tool. Then, adjust the derailleur’s cable tension and limit screws to improve shifting performance.
